创建持久节点和临时节点

ZooKeeper zk=new ZooKeeper(HOST,CLIENT_SESSION_TIMEOUT,new Watcher(){@Overridepublic void process(WatchedEvent event) {logger.info("---watcher--eventtype=="+event.getType());}});//创建持久节点if(zk.exists(LEADER_PATH,false)==null){zk.create(LEADER_PATH, null,Ids.OPEN_ACL_UNSAFE, CreateMode.PERSISTENT);}//创建临时节点path=zk.create(LEADER_PATH+"/lock-", null,Ids.OPEN_ACL_UNSAFE, CreateMode.EPHEMERAL_SEQUENTIAL);

转载于:https://www.cnblogs.com/davidwang456/p/5127412.html

zookeeper应用实例相关推荐

  1. java zookeeper_Java zookeeper开发实例

    1.安装zookeeper 下载zk http://archive.cloudera.com/cdh5/cdh/5/ 配置文件tickTime=2000 initLimit=10 syncLimit= ...

  2. dubbo+zookeeper+spring实例

    互联网的发展,网站应用的规模不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流动计算架构势在必行,Dubbo是一个分布式服务框架,在这种情况下诞生的.现在核心业务抽取出来,作为独立的服务,使 ...

  3. 清华大佬教你一招最便捷搭建 Zookeeper 的方法!

    什么是 ZooKeeper ZooKeeper 是 Apache 的一个顶级项目,为分布式应用提供高效.高可用的分布式协调服务,提供了诸如数据发布/订阅.负载均衡.命名服务.分布式协调/通知和分布式锁 ...

  4. ZooKeeper伪分布式集群安装及使用

    为什么80%的码农都做不了架构师?>>>    ZooKeeper伪分布式集群安装及使用 让Hadoop跑在云端系列文章,介绍了如何整合虚拟化和Hadoop,让Hadoop集群跑在V ...

  5. 构建高可用ZooKeeper集群(转载)

    ZooKeeper 是 Apache 的一个顶级项目,为分布式应用提供高效.高可用的分布式协调服务,提供了诸如数据发布/订阅.负载均衡.命名服务.分布式协调/通知和分布式锁等分布式基础服务.由于 Zo ...

  6. ZooKeeper伪分布式集群安装

    为什么80%的码农都做不了架构师?>>>    获取ZooKeeper安装包 下载地址:http://apache.dataguru.cn/zookeeper 选择一个稳定版本进行下 ...

  7. Zookeeper系列(十)zookeeper的服务端启动详述

    作者:leesf    掌控之中,才会成功:掌控之外,注定失败.出处:http://www.cnblogs.com/leesf456/p/6105276.html尊重原创,大家功能学习进步: 一.前言 ...

  8. 如何构建高可用ZooKeeper集群

    ZooKeeper 是 Apache 的一个顶级项目,为分布式应用提供高效.高可用的分布式协调服务,提供了诸如数据发布/订阅.负载均衡.命名服务.分布式协调/通知和分布式锁等分布式基础服务.由于 Zo ...

  9. ZooKeeper学习第二期--ZooKeeper安装配置

    一.Zookeeper的搭建方式 Zookeeper安装方式有三种,单机模式和集群模式以及伪集群模式. ■ 单机模式:Zookeeper只运行在一台服务器上,适合测试环境: ■ 伪集群模式:就是在一台 ...

最新文章

  1. Java并发学习一:CPU缓存导致的可见性问题带来的并发Bug
  2. spark sql 上个月_SPARK-SQL内置函数之时间日期类
  3. angular.js phonecat翻译
  4. weblogic缓存导致的网页验证码无法获取到
  5. java文件异步上传_[Java教程]原生javascript实现文件异步上传
  6. console 一行_你还在用 console.log 调试?
  7. Image:介绍一些跟图片有关的控件,如图片展示特效,图片生产,图片保护等
  8. 解决VisualStudio 05/08智能提示显示1秒钟
  9. Day9-HTML body属性
  10. arcgis地图服务之 identify 服务
  11. C++ Qt学习笔记 (1) 简易计算器设计
  12. maven eclipse 编译错误 Dynamic Web Module 3.0 requires Java 1.6 or new
  13. mysql 1690_mysql error BIGINT UNSIGNED value is out of range in 解决办法
  14. 虚拟服务器内存性能指标,vSphere 虚拟环境中超额配置 CPU、 内存和存储的比例推荐及规划简述...
  15. HTML5添加网页音效
  16. flutter 轮播组件 Swiper
  17. 浏览器网页打开与关闭快捷键
  18. php公用函数:获取字符串中英文混合长度
  19. 5个高清图片素材网站,免费商用,赶紧收藏~
  20. 源于日本的工作之道“守破离”是个学习路径的好方法

热门文章

  1. android 关闭2g网络,中国联通将关闭2G网络,速来了解联通2g卡升级4g套餐方法
  2. postman请求soap 请求_postman中请求如何传递对象到spring controller?
  3. bootstrap账号和文本框在同一行_实用小工具之整理行
  4. python取百位数个位数_使用Python把数值形式的金额变成人类可读形式
  5. 怎么批量抠复杂的图_怎么用手机修图,抠图、拼图,证件照制作?
  6. java 查找 替换_java 查找、替换
  7. android 之DatePicker以及TimePicker的用法
  8. 如何启用用计算机iis,win7系统如何开启iis功能?电脑iis功能启用图文步骤教程...
  9. mysql set bulk_insert_buffer_size
  10. Python 位运算符号